After Hurricane Irene left a lot of people without power here in the
Northeast, customers who have grid-tied systems are asking about some
battery backup to power some essential loads.
We have used Sunny Islands but they require either 2 Sunny Islands or
a step up transformer to get 240 volts for the well pump. Schneider
Electric (Xantrex XW) inverters look like they would work for this
application and do 120/240 volt output as well and we have used these
in off grid applications but not as AC coupled. I have considered
Magnum because they also do 120/240 volts but they need battery
diversion to ensure the batteries are not over charged.
None of these systems are going to be rewired as a DC system so I am
looking for any feed back on what others are using to AC couple to
existing grid-tied systems to provide some battery backup.
